In mouse, genes X, Y and Z are on chromosome 2. The map of genes X, Y and Z is:
XYZ
20 m. u. 30 m. u.
You cross an individual with genotype XXYYZZ to an individual with genotype xxyyzz, and F1 progeny are collected. Assume interference between regions (X-Y and Y-Z) is 100%. When an F1 individual produces gametes, what proportion of its gametes would have xyz genotype?
a. 10%
b. 20%
c. 25%
d. 30%
e. 40%
f. 50%
g. 0%
h. None of these above
